My Honda Lawnmower HRS216PDC, engine GCV160 was being used to mulch leaves when the user hit a stump and the mower stopped.  It continues to start easily but now has an obvious vibration.  The blade has no bend to the eye.  Is it likely that the crankshaft is bent or are there other, hopefully less catastrophic, causes for the problem?

 Sorry for the Delay. Remove the Spark Plug. Tilt the Mower so the Plug Hole is Up. Carefully Turn the Engine and Watch the Blade Mounting Bolt. Does the Bolt Turn True or Does it Wobble when the Engine is Turned? If the Answer is Yes it Wobbles, then the Crankshaft is Bent. If the Answer is No it Doesn't Wobble, then the Blade is Bent or Off Balance. Hope this Helps. I am here if you Require more Assistance. Let me know what Happens, Please. Thanks.
